COVID-19: We Will No Longer Re-open Religious Centres – Benua State Govt

Benue State Government on Saturday said it will no longer re-opening of worship places and market amidst the coronavirus pandemic.

This is coming two days after the government ordered for the re-opening of religious centers.

The reversal, Governor Samuel Ortom said, was premised on the federal government’s advice to states to be cautious about restarting economic and social activities.

According to the Nigeria Centre for Disease Control, Benue has recorded five cases of COVID-19 as of Friday.
